Brightsdale Forest Management Unit
The Brightsdale Forest Management Unit is a pet-friendly, 900-acre segment of Richard J. Dorer Memorial Hardwood State Forest in Lanesboro, MN. Named after a historic hydroelectric plant along the Root River, it boasts a 5-mile interpretive trail offering educational tours of the forest. During the summer, the cross-country ski trails double as excellent hiking paths, providing opportunities for outdoor exploration and environmental education.
